Abstract
一种多位元触发器(1),所述多位元触发器(1)包括时脉输入引脚(PINI)、时脉缓冲电路(110)及多个触发器(121~128)。时脉缓冲电路(110)用来接收自时脉输入引脚(PINI)所收到的第一时脉信号(CP),并且根据第一时脉信号(CP)提供第二时脉信号与第三时脉信号。而每一触发器(121~128)均用来接收第二时脉信号与第三时脉信号,并且根据第二时脉信号与第三时脉信号来存储数据。因此,所述多位元触发器(1)是设计让每一触发器(121~128)均能共用同一时脉。另提出一种包括所述的多位元触发器(1)的电子设备。
